RAC日常监控

来源:互联网 发布:网狐荣耀棋牌源码 编辑:程序博客网 时间:2024/06/18 02:46
所有实例和服务的状态

$ srvctl status database -d racdb
Instance orcl1 is running on node linux1
Instance orcl2 is running on node linux2

特定节点上节点应用程序的状态

$ srvctl status nodeapps -n linux1
VIP is running on node: linux1
GSD is running on node: linux1
Listener is running on node: linux1
ONS daemon is running on node: linux1

ASM 实例的状态

$ srvctl status asm -n linux1
ASM instance +ASM1 is running on node linux1.

列出配置的所有数据库

$ srvctl config database
racdb

集群中所有正在运行的实例

SELECT
inst_id
, instance_number inst_no
, instance_name inst_name
, parallel
, status
, database_status db_status
, active_state state
, host_name host
FROM gv$instance
ORDER BY inst_id;

INST_ID INST_NO INST_NAME PAR STATUS DB_STATUS STATE HOST
-------- -------- ---------- --- ------- ------------ --------- -------
1 1 orcl1 YES OPEN ACTIVE NORMAL rac1
2 2 orcl2 YES OPEN ACTIVE NORMAL rac2

位于磁盘组中的所有数据文件

select name from v$datafile
union
select member from v$logfile
union
select name from v$controlfile
union
select name from v$tempfile;

属于“ORCL_DATA1”磁盘组的所有 ASM 磁盘

SELECT path
FROM v$asm_disk
WHERE group_number IN (select group_number
from v$asm_diskgroup
where name = 'ORCL_DATA1');

PATH
----------------------------------
ORCL:VOL1
ORCL:VOL2

检查集群节点

/opt/ora10g/product/10.2.0/crs_1/bin/olsnodes -n
linux1 1
linux2 2

配置 Oracle 集群件功能

/opt/ora10g/product/10.2.0/crs_1/bin/crs_stat -t –v

检查 CRS 状态

/opt/ora10g/product/10.2.0/crs_1/bin/crsctl check crs

查看监听器

ps -ef | grep lsnr | grep -v 'grep' | grep -v 'ocfs' | awk '{print $9}'

[@more@]


原创粉丝点击